Core value of the solution: From “single-point intelligence” to “holistic wisdom”

1. Comprehensive security, proactive protection

  • Intelligent early warning system:  Based on AI video analysis, it can proactively identify and alarm for personnel intrusion, overcrowding in areas, obstruction of fire lanes, and dangerous behaviors, transforming “post-event investigation” into “pre-event prevention”.
  • Integrated command and dispatch:  Seamlessly integrates video, access control, patrol, alarm, and fire protection systems to achieve one-click linkage of alarm events and visualized emergency command, significantly improving the park’s security level and response efficiency.
  • Convenient and seamless passage:  Through technologies such as facial recognition and vehicle recognition, employees can be clocked in and out without any contact, visitors can be invited online, and vehicles can be released automatically, improving the passage experience and efficiency.

2. Intelligent operation, cost reduction and efficiency improvement

  • Intelligent management and control of facilities and equipment:  Online monitoring and intelligent control of equipment such as air conditioning, lighting, elevators, water supply and drainage in the park to achieve preventive maintenance and reduce energy consumption and operation and maintenance costs.
  • Smart Energy Management:  Real-time monitoring of energy consumption such as water, electricity, and gas; energy analysis and optimization through AI algorithms; generation of energy-saving strategies; and assistance to the park in achieving its “dual carbon” goals.
  • Digital twin park:  Construct a 3D visualization model of the park to achieve digital mapping of all elements such as assets, equipment, environment, and energy, support “one map” management, and make decision-making more intuitive and accurate.

3. Convenient services enhance the user experience.

  • One-stop service platform:  Through a dedicated APP or mini-program, it provides “finger-tip” services for employees of companies in the park, including online repair reporting, visitor appointment, meeting room booking, catering reservation, bill inquiry, and information release.
  • Smart office space:  Provides value-added services such as smart meeting rooms (one-click start, online booking), shared workstations, and smart printing to improve employee work efficiency and satisfaction.
  • Smart investment attraction and industrial services:  Utilizing big data to analyze the industrial ecosystem of the park and provide data support for precise investment attraction; connecting with third-party services such as policy, finance, and law to build a complete industrial service chain.

4. Data-driven, innovation-empowered

  • Unified Data Platform:  Breaks down data barriers between various business systems, aggregates all data on “people, vehicles, things, events, and spaces” in the park, and forms the park’s data assets.
  • Intelligent decision support:  Through multi-dimensional data analysis, we can gain insights into the park’s operational status, provide scientific basis for enterprise distribution, service support, and resource allocation, and empower the park to achieve data-driven continuous optimization and business model innovation.
